Adjustment Procedure
Illustration 3 g01187838
Open the cover on the right side of the machine in order to access the main control valve.Adjustment (P1)
Illustration 4 g01187863
Main control valve (10) Main relief valve (P1)
Illustration 5 g01156988
Main relief valve (typical example) (13) Locknut (14) Adjustment screw
Loosen locknut (13) . Turn adjustment screw (14) clockwise in order to increase the pressure. Turn adjustment screw (14) counterclockwise in order to decrease the pressure. Tighten locknut (13) after the adjustment is made.Note: Always make final pressure adjustment on pressure rise.Adjustment (P2)
Illustration 6 g01187864
Main control valve (11) Main relief valve (P2)
Illustration 7 g01156988
Main relief valve (typical example) (13) Locknut (14) Adjustment screw
Loosen locknut (13) . Turn adjustment screw (14) clockwise in order to increase the pressure. Turn adjustment screw (14) counterclockwise in order to decrease the pressure. Tighten locknut (13) after the adjustment is made.Note: Always make final pressure adjustment on pressure rise.Adjustment (P3)
Illustration 8 g01187867
Main control valve (12) Main relief valve (P3)
Illustration 9 g01156988
Main relief valve (typical example) (13) Locknut (14) Adjustment screw
Loosen locknut (13) . Turn adjustment screw (14) clockwise in order to increase the pressure. Turn adjustment screw (14) counterclockwise in order to decrease the pressure. Tighten locknut (13) after the adjustment is made.Note: Always make final pressure adjustment on pressure rise.Temporary Setting of the Main Relief Valves
Note: A temporary setting of the main relief valve is required before any line relief valve can be adjusted.
The temporary pressure value of the main relief valve should be 28950 250 kPa (4200 36 psi). If the main relief valves are not within the specification, adjust the main relief valve pressure setting to the correct pressure specification. Refer to Testing and Adjusting, "Relief Valve (Main) - Test and Adjust".
Illustration 10 g01187819
Main control valve (10) Main relief valve for the boom, bucket, and left travel control valves (P1) (11) Main relief valve for the stick, auxiliary, and right travel control valves (P2) (12) Main relief valve for the swing and blade control valves (P3)
Illustration 11 g01156988
Main relief valve (typical example) (13) Locknut (14) Adjustment screw
Loosen locknut (13) . Turn adjustment screw (14) clockwise for one half turn. Tighten locknut (13) after the adjustment is made.
